Services & Process

Tree service companies in Lexington typically handle everything from routine crown trimming to full tree removal on tight residential lots. Trimming involves cutting back dead or overgrown branches to improve structure and reduce hazard risk, while removal requires safely felling and hauling away the entire tree. Stump grinding is usually a separate step, using a machine to shred the remaining stump below ground level. Many local crews also respond to storm damage, clearing fallen limbs and debris after the severe weather events that move through central Kentucky each spring and summer.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does tree removal typically cost in Lexington, KY?
Costs vary widely depending on tree size, location, and how difficult access is on your property. A small tree under 30 feet might run a few hundred dollars, while a large oak near a structure can cost significantly more. Getting two or three quotes is always a smart move before committing.
Do I need a permit to remove a tree on my property in Lexington?
In most residential cases in Lexington-Fayette County, you don't need a permit for removing trees on private property. However, there are exceptions for certain protected trees or properties in specific zoning areas, so it's worth checking with the local urban forestry office if you're unsure.
What's the best time of year to trim trees in Kentucky?
Late fall through early spring is generally the best window for trimming most deciduous trees in Kentucky, since the trees are dormant and it's easier to see the branch structure. Some species, like oaks, should be trimmed in winter to reduce the risk of disease spread. Emergency trimming can be done any time of year when safety is a concern.
Is stump grinding included with tree removal, or is it extra?
Most tree service companies price stump grinding separately from tree removal. It's worth asking upfront whether the quote includes grinding, because leaving a stump can attract pests and make mowing difficult. Some companies offer a discount when you bundle removal and grinding together.
How do I know if a tree on my property is actually dangerous?
Signs to watch for include large dead branches, cracks in the trunk, leaning that wasn't there before, and fungal growth at the base. If a tree is close to your home or a power line, it's worth having a professional take a look rather than waiting. A quick site visit from a tree service can give you a clearer picture.
Will the crew clean up all the debris after the job?
Most reputable tree service companies in Lexington include debris removal and cleanup in their quote, though it's always good to confirm this before work starts. They'll typically chip branches on-site and haul away the logs. Some homeowners ask to keep the wood for firewood, and many crews are happy to accommodate that.
